In the case of chemical reactions, it is impossible to get a yield more than 100% . If this happen this mean you may have some impurities in your product and you should purify it. If you use an excess amount of the reactant, may be your product still contains the unreacted reactant. Some products could adsorb water or other used solvent during separation and purification process.

    In a chemical reaction, the reactant that limits the amount of product that can be formed is called the limiting reactant (or limiting reagent). The reaction will stop when all of the limiting reactant is consumed. In the sandwich example, bread was our limiting reactant. The reactant or reactants in a chemical reaction that remain when a reaction stops when the limiting reactant is completely consumed are called the excess reactant(s).
